Description

The Kunlun Beijing, a combination of classic and modern, sits right along the shore of Liangma River, is situated in Beijing Chaoyang Central Business District. The hotel is surrounded by many restaurants and also offers 10 restaurants and 3 bars on site. An indoor pool, free internet, plus a 24-hour business centre are also provided. The Kunlun Beijing is a 15-minute drive from Beijing Capital International Airport. Beijing Railway Station is 15 km away, while Dongzhimen Subway Station is 5 km away. Full length windows in guestrooms create calm ambiance. Individually designed, all rooms at Kunlun Hotel overlook the scenic Liangma River. Amenities include a cable TV, tea/coffee maker and personal safe. Guests can lounge by the Roman-style hot tub or exercise at the gym. There is also a sauna and well-equipped gym. To release pressure, try a herbal bath or a massage therapy at Fortune Health Centre. Laundry services and car rentals with driver are available. The property also offers well-equipped meeting rooms and spaces. Xian Yan Restaurant serves authentic Sichuan dishes and traditional Chinese music performances. For Cantonese cuisine, you may hit order at Jin Yan Restaurant. Other dining options include Japanese, Korean and Western cuisines. To enjoy cocktails, the on-site bars and lounges are ideal venues.

Cochabamba is known as the "City of Eternal Spring" due to its mild climate and lush vegetation. As the fourth largest city in Bolivia, Cochabamba offers a unique blend of modern amenities and traditional charm.
One of the most iconic landmarks in Cochabamba is the Cristo de la Concordia, a towering statue of Jesus Christ that overlooks the city from the top of San Pedro Hill. You can take a cable car ride up to the statue for bre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and valleys.
For a taste of local culture, visit the Feria de la Cancha, an open-air market where vendors sell everything from fresh produce to handmade crafts. The market is bustling with activity and offers a great opportunity to interact with the friendly locals.
